Helpful Hints
May 27, 2010Helpful hints – please read! Customer service is available M-F 8:30-4:30 at 949-824-1467, or if no answer, 824-RIDE. Please make sure your ZotWheels bike is locked into place by slightly lifting the basket when returning and check it to make sure lock is secure. Lock bikes into ZotWheels station or on a bike rack using a bike lock when not in use (we find unlocked bikes!). The bolts on the seat adjustment have been securely tightened so only adjust lever when moving seat up and down. Make sure bike is in first gear when starting up. Make sure tires are inflated before you ride. Please choose another bike and let us know if a low air bike is found. Grand Opening
October 9, 2009ZotWheels celebrated its grand opening today on the lawn at the Student Center. About 60 people attended including representatives from the California Assembly, the City of Irvine, UCI’s rideshare partners, OCTA, SCAQMD, VPSI, and many from our campus community. The media were there to capture the event including the Daily Pilot, Bicycle Retailer and Industry News, and Channel 7 who filmed and reported a spot that aired that afternoon. Click here to view the video.
After Transportation and Distribution Services staff welcomed guests and spoke about ZotWheels, Vice Chancellor of A&BS Wendell Brase cut the ribbon on the Student Center station. Parking staff were on hand to demonstrate how the system works and bikes were made available for riding. The ZotWheels membership campaign will begin over the next few weeks.

ZotWheels Locations
August 4, 2009Major planning for ZotWheels installation is commencing! The four locations are the lower Student Center, Langson Library service road, Science Library at Ring Mall, and South Circle View Dr. at Ring Mall on the other side of the University Club.
ZotWheels: Coming Fall 2009!
July 14, 2009Soon to be located at key locations around the campus core, the bikes will allow campus community members a greener and more convenient method of transportation around the UC Irvine campus. Membership to use ZotWheels will be available online. Welcome kits, including a bike helmet and water bottle will be given to the first 250 new members.
